A central air conditioning conditioner cools air in one spot prior to distributing it throughout the home utilizing the furnace’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ly small areas and require numerous systems to cool the entire home.
A lot of single-family houses in the United States with central air conditioning use a split system. This implies that the gadget is divided into two par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the house outside.

Your professional will assist you in identifying the suitable size central air conditioning conditioner for your home. A system that is too small will run almost continually, whereas a system that is too big will chill the home too rapidly and shut down prior to finishing a full c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ter scenario is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from streaming. As a outcome, a big air conditioning system may be less effective at cooling than a smaller sized unit.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a estimation called a “Manual-J” to identify the very best unit for your house. This will consider all of the specifications we’ve discussed and more, resulting in the most accurate size possible.
However, we comprehend that numerous house owners like to have a basic concept of what size they need ahead of time. Here’s a rough estimation of main air conditioner size: To get the Btu required, increase the square video of your house’s conditioned location by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is merely a basic price quote, and there are numerous aspects. If your home’s very first flooring has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Rates vary based upon the local market and the job details, just like any substantial project. For labor and supplies, a typical split system central air conditioning installation utilizing an existing furnace might c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that expense will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for majority of it.
